Rocky Hill Taekwondo Students Compete in National Tournament
More than half of the students from the Olympic Taekwondo Academy are participating in their first national event.

Students from the participated in the USA Taekwondo National Championships in Dallas over the weekend.
Nicole Felice, 15, and Elena McKinney, 7, of Rocky Hill competed in the sparring, forms and breaking events, a release from the academy stated. There were 17 students, who are between the ages of seven to 15, from Olympic Taekwondo Academy locations in and .

Felice and McKinney are part of the Team Light of the World, which has been practicing since last September to prepare for the national championships, which ends Monday. For more than half of the team, it was their first time competing on a national stage, the release said. The team was trained by Masters Kiye Cho, Taewoo Lee, Jonguk Jang, Kwangsoon Park, and Sunmi Jung.
To qualify, athletes must have competed in a 2012 USAT state championship, regional qualifier or received a waiver, according to the release.
